The Benefits of a Skincare Routine
Studies have shown that following a consistent skincare routine can lead to numerous benefits for your skin. According to a survey conducted by the American Academy of Dermatology, individuals who have a regular skincare regimen are more likely to have healthier and younger-looking skin compared to those who do not.
Key benefits of a skincare routine include:
- Improved skin texture and tone
- Reduced signs of aging, such as fine lines and wrinkles
- Prevention of skin conditions, such as acne and eczema
- Protection against environmental factors, such as UV rays and pollution
The Affordability of Skincare
Many people assume that effective Skincare Products come with a hefty price tag. However, data shows that affordable skincare options can be just as beneficial as their more expensive counterparts. According to a study published in the Journal of Drugs in Dermatology, inexpensive Skincare Products containing key ingredients like retinol and hyaluronic acid have been proven to deliver noticeable results when used consistently.

Tips for Building an Affordable Skincare Routine
Creating a skincare routine under $30 a month is easily achievable with the right approach. Here are some tips to help you get started:
- Invest in multi-purpose products that offer multiple benefits in one, such as a moisturizer with SPF protection.
- Prioritize key ingredients that are proven to be effective, such as vitamin C for brightening and niacinamide for evening skin tone.
- Look for cost-effective alternatives to popular skincare trends, such as DIY face masks using natural ingredients like honey and yogurt.
